The cost of slab mudjacking in Allentown, PA can vary depending on several factors. Mudjacking, also known as slabjacking or concrete leveling, is a cost-effective solution to repair sunken or uneven concrete surfaces. It involves pumping a mixture of water, soil, and cement underneath the slab to lift it back to its original position. This method is commonly used for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other concrete surfaces.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and time.
- Extent of Damage: Severe damage might need additional repair work.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as can increase labor costs.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may require extra preparation.
- Type of Slab: Different slabs may require different techniques.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ates can vary.
- Material Costs: Prices for the mudjacking mixture can fluctuate.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ost |
---|---|
Driveway Mudjacking | $600 - $1,200 |
Sidewalk Mudjacking | $300 - $800 |
Patio Mudjacking | $400 - $1,000 |
Garage Floor Mudjacking | $500 - $1,200 |
Basement Floor Mudjacking | $800 - $1,500 |
